> As Lonni helpfully points out and is very very correct, although
> you can get compiz to work with aiglx on FC5, it's much much
> simpler if you move over to FC6. Although I did manage to get FC5
> working with compiz and AIGLX, it wasn't at all stable for me and
> certainly wasn't fun to work on. I highly recommend FC6 for this.
> 
> During periods of high activity on my desktop, the mouse seems to
> have a bit of trouble tracking. YMMV, but I thought I'd point that
> out to you. It does look very good though. 

So far the only problem Ive seen is that some applications menus break
up into digital spaghetti. Otherwise it runs pretty well. Dvd playback
is slower. Methinks with some tweaking it'll be usable for now. It looks
nice as Hell, and now I'm spoiled. I'll wait for FC6.2 though. Ric
